Subject: [PATCH 1/7] i2c: at91-master: : use proper DMAENGINE API for termination

dmaengine_terminate_all() is deprecated in favor of explicitly saying if
it should be sync or async. Here, we want dmaengine_terminate_sync()
because there is no other synchronization code in the driver to handle
an async case.

dr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91-master.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91-master.c b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91-master.c
index 1cceb6866689..b0eae94909f4 100644
--- a/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91-master.c
+++ b/drivers/i2c/busses/i2c-at91-master.c
@@ -138,9 +138,9 @@ static void at91_twi_dma_cleanup(struct at91_twi_dev *dev)
if (dma->xfer_in_progress) {
if (dma->direction == DMA_FROM_DEVICE)
- dmaengine_terminate_all(dma->chan_rx);
+ dmaengine_terminate_sync(dma->chan_rx);
else
- dmaengine_terminate_all(dma->chan_tx);
+ dmaengine_terminate_sync(dma->chan_tx);
dma->xfer_in_progress = false;
}
if (dma->buf_mapped) {
